I've noticed it only happens with some programs. With Claws Mail, when I move the mouse pointer to the X to close, the whole box around the x turns blue and I can click anywhere in the box and it will close, the same when playing Freecell. Only when using Firefox ESR do I have the problem, and I use it most of the time. I'm not giving up MX Linux, I'll just learn to live with it.
